It is with great sadness that we inform you of the passing of Pat G3IOR who passed away today, Thursday 17th August, at the age of 85.
Pat had been ill for some time and passed away peacefully at Cavell Court with his wife Norma and friend John G0MXN by his bedside.
Pat has always been a big part of the Amateur Radio Community for many years, teaching and elmering many of our members, including Roger G3LDI who has known him since he was 14 and in fact was Best Man at Pat and Normas wedding.
As well as teaching radio amateurs in his personal life, Pat was a Technician and instructor at Norwich City College and so helped many launch their career in electronics. He was also passionate about the coastlines of Norfolk and in particular the effects of coastal erosion, spending a large part of his life campaigning for this cause.
